<p>#CMT# #/CMT# Extraction of active principles from plants to increase the rate and to ensure the stabilization of acylphloroglucinol in these extracts, comprises subjecting the extracts in a suitable pH zone, followed by drying by vacuum dehydration at low temperature on zeolite. #CMT# : #/CMT# Independent claims are included for: (1) an extract obtained by the process containing 2-8% of hyperforin in combination with a mineral salt; and (2) compositions containing the extract obtained by the process used for the therapeutic and/or para-pharmaceutical use, comprising the extract (300 mg) with approximately 2% of hyperforin, magnesium element (10 mg) in the form of salts and magnesium (120 mg) as magnesium citrate. #CMT#ACTIVITY : #/CMT# CNS-Gen.; Gastrointestinal-Gen.; No biological data given. #CMT#MECHANISM OF ACTION : #/CMT# None given. #CMT#USE : #/CMT# The invention deals with the extraction of active principles, particularly from Hypericum perforatum (claimed). #CMT#ADVANTAGE : #/CMT# The extraction method increases the rate and ensures the stabilization of acylphloroglucinol in active principles extracted from plants (claimed). The extraction method provides improved stability of active ingredients. #CMT#BIOLOGY : #/CMT# Preferred Components: The plant extract is Hypericum perforatum extract having a hyperforin concentration of 2-8%, preferably 3-5%. #CMT#PHARMACEUTICALS : #/CMT# Preferred Process: The stabilization of acylphloroglucinol is obtained by salification of acylphloroglucinol by various alkaline agents, preferably soda, magnesium hydroxide and calcium hydroxide. The salification is effected by metallic salts, triethanolamine or triethylamine. The extract in the form of salt, is transformed into base by controlled acidification of the extraction solutions using a mineral/organic acid e.g. hydrochloric acid, sulfuric acid, phosphoric acid, citric acid or ascorbic acid. The extract in salified form is isolated, followed by addition of citric acid and/or ascorbic acid or other antioxidants to improve its physical state. The process further comprises addition of dilution additives e.g. maltodextrins and/or lubricants e.g. metallic stearates and slipping agents e.g. citric acid or silicic acid to facilitate the pharmaceutical formulation. The extract obtained by the process is added with magnesium citrate. Preferred Composition: The composition is incorporated with active ingredients acting on gastro-intestinal and/or central nervous system, preferably on central nervous system e.g. polyunsaturated fatty acid of omega-3 series. #CMT#EXAMPLE : #/CMT# Typical composition comprised (in kg): Hypericum perforatum extract (30); magnesium citrate (12); sodium croscarmellose (5.2); microcrystalline cellulose (14.905); glycerol dibehenate (0.676); and colloidal silica (0.219).</p> |
